格式設定函數
格式設定函數會強制設定輸入數值欄位或運算式的顯示格式,根據資料類型,您可以指定小數點分隔符號、千位分隔符號等的字元。
函數全部會傳回同時具有字串和數值,但是可以視為執行數字到字串轉換的雙值。Dual() 是一種特殊情況,但是其他格式化函數會採用輸入運算式的數值,並產生代表數字的字串。
而解譯函數執行相反的操作:它們會使用字串運算式並評估為數字,指定所產生數字的格式。
這些函數可以同時用於資料載入指令碼和圖表運算式中。
資訊備註所有的數字表示法都會加入小數點作為小數點分隔符號。
使用每個函數中的下拉式功能表,以查看每個函數的簡要描述及語法。按一下語法描述中的函數名稱,以取得進一步詳細資料。
ApplyCodepage() 在運算式中指明的欄位或文字上套用不同的代碼頁面字元設定。codepage 引數必須為數字格式。
ApplyCodePage (text,
codepage)
Date() 將運算式的格式設定為日期,使用在資料載入指令碼或作業系統或格式字串 (如果提供的話) 的系統變數中設定的格式。
Date(number[, format])
Dual() 將一個數字與一個字串組合至單一記錄,例如記錄的數字表示法可用於排序及計算,而字串值可用於顯示。
Dual(text, number)
Interval() 將數字的格式設定為時間間隔,使用在資料載入指令碼或作業系統或格式字串 (如果提供的話) 的系統變數中設定的格式。
Interval(number[, format])
Money() 將運算式的格式以數值方式設定為金額值,使用在資料載入指令碼或作業系統 (除非提供格式字串) 的系統變數集中設定的格式,以及選用的小數與千位分隔符號。
Money(number[, format[, dec_sep
[, thou_sep]]])
Num() 格式化數字,亦即使用第二參數指定的格式將輸入的數值轉換為顯示文字。若省略第二參數,這會使用資料載入指令碼中設定的小數點和千位分隔符號。自訂小數與千位分隔符號是選用參數。
Num(number[, format[, dec_sep
[, thou_sep]]])
Time() 將運算式的格式設定為時間值,使用在資料載入指令碼或作業系統 (除非提供格式字串) 的系統變數中設定的時間格式。
Time(number[, format])
TimeStamp() 將運算式的格式設定為日期和時間值,使用在資料載入指令碼或作業系統 (除非提供格式字串) 的系統變數中設定的時間戳記格式。
Timestamp(number[,
format])